$75K in Jewelry Stolen from Newport Home

The jewelry was stolen from a home on Gorham Drive on Thursday night, police reported.

Jewelry worth $75,000 was stolen from a home in Newport Beach on Thursday night, police reported.

The home burglary took place sometime between 6:10 and 11:15 p.m. at a home in the 4500 block of Gorham Drive. According to police, the suspect pried open a rear sliding glass door which led into the master bedroom of the home.

Police said the jewelry was stolen from a closet.
